summaryrefslogtreecommitdiffstats
path: root/usecaseui-portal/src/app/core/services
diff options
context:
space:
mode:
authorcyuamber <xuranyjy@chinamobile.com>2019-12-09 16:58:55 +0800
committercyuamber <xuranyjy@chinamobile.com>2019-12-09 16:59:01 +0800
commit2ec3c8dbf2644f3e99e5494620b2811c5dccbac0 (patch)
tree8c6255918ab24591a7ac13ff1ec8644ff2e58105 /usecaseui-portal/src/app/core/services
parent817390e74ff1aefebc1d5ed5853d9d95ff283a99 (diff)
feat:add monitor echarts data of api function of monitor 5g page
Change-Id: If0f76e8dec5c580b2144ff2f334aea063433ac9f Issue-ID: USECASEUI-370 Signed-off-by: cyuamber <xuranyjy@chinamobile.com>
Diffstat (limited to 'usecaseui-portal/src/app/core/services')
-rw-r--r--usecaseui-portal/src/app/core/services/slicingTaskServices.ts18
1 files changed, 18 insertions, 0 deletions
diff --git a/usecaseui-portal/src/app/core/services/slicingTaskServices.ts b/usecaseui-portal/src/app/core/services/slicingTaskServices.ts
index 3380d832..bf74fea7 100644
--- a/usecaseui-portal/src/app/core/services/slicingTaskServices.ts
+++ b/usecaseui-portal/src/app/core/services/slicingTaskServices.ts
@@ -47,6 +47,10 @@ export class SlicingTaskServices {
slicingNssiList:this.baseUrl+"/resource/nssi/instances/pageNo/{pageNo}/pageSize/{pageSize}",
slicingNssiQueryOfStatus:this.baseUrl+"/resource/nssi/{instanceStatus}/instances/pageNo/{pageNo}/pageSize/{pageSize}",
slicingNssiDetail:this.baseUrl+"/resource/nssi/{nssiId}/details",
+ //monitor 5G
+ fetchTraffic:this.baseUrl+"/monitoring/queryTimestamp/{queryTimestamp}/trafficData",
+ fetchOnlineusers:this.baseUrl+"/monitoring/queryTimestamp/{queryTimestamp}/onlineUsers",
+ fetchBandwidth:this.baseUrl+"/monitoring/queryTimestamp/{queryTimestamp}/bandwidth"
}
@@ -163,6 +167,20 @@ export class SlicingTaskServices {
let url = this.url.slicingNssiDetail.replace("{nssiId}",nssiId);
return this.http.get<any>(url);
}
+ //monitor 5G
+ getFetchTraffic(service_list,time){
+ let url = this.url.fetchTraffic.replace("{queryTimestamp}",time);
+ return this.http.post<any>(url,service_list);
+ }
+ getFetchOnlineusers(service_list,time){
+ let url = this.url.fetchOnlineusers.replace("{queryTimestamp}",time);
+ return this.http.post<any>(url,service_list);
+ }
+ getFetchBandwidth(service_list,time){
+ let url = this.url.fetchBandwidth.replace("{queryTimestamp}",time);
+ return this.http.post<any>(url,service_list);
+ }
+
}